Lockheed Prepares to Resume F-35 Deliveries in Q3 with Updated Standard

Lockheed Martin anticipates the restart of F-35 stealth fighter deliveries to the US Department of Defense in Q3, featuring aircraft in an enhanced "combat training-capable" standard.
